About this Item:
  • Built with and for esports athletes for competition-level performance, speed and precision.
  • Durable GX Blue Click switches deliver an audible and tactile click for a solid, secure keypress.
  • Ultra-portable compact ten keyless design frees up table space for mouse movement. It's easy to pack up and transport to tournaments.
  • Use LIGHTSYNC to highlight keys and program static lighting patterns to onboard memory for tournament systems that don't allow G HUB installations.
  • Detachable Micro USB cables feature a three-pronged design for an easy, secure connection and safe transport in your travel bag.
  • 3-step angle adjustment for additional levels of comfort, plus rubber feet for excellent stability during intense gaming.
  • Execute a set of complex or timed actions or commands with the press of a button. F-key (F1-F12) programming and use requires Logitech G HUB software. Keyboard macros are generally not allowed in tournaments. Programming keys and lighting requires Logitech G HUB software.

I've had three of these keyboards and all three of them have had anywhere from 3 to 10 LEDs under the keys lose one of the R, G, or B color within 10 months. Even the board I had RMA'd had this issue.

I love the feel of the keyboard and the software is great. Unfortunately, the LEDs aren't as robust as I was expecting. They may have fixed this issue within the last 6 months, but I've stopped purchasing Logitech keyboards with LEDs.
